Cascade Space Secures $5.9M in Seed Funding for Space Communication System Design Platform
Cascade Space, a San Francisco-based company specializing in end-to-end communication system design, recently announced a successful Seed funding round, raising a total of $5.9 million. The funding will play a crucial role in accelerating the development of the company’s platform for satellite communication system design.
Investors in this funding round included Nova Threshold, Undeterred Capital, Y Combinator, and several others, demonstrating strong support for Cascade Space’s mission. This financial backing will enable the company to further enhance its platform, catering to the specific needs of space communication systems.
Founded in 2025 and spearheaded by CEO Jacob Portukalian, Cascade Space is dedicated to revolutionizing the space communication industry. The company’s platform offers comprehensive solutions for design, test, and operation of space communication systems, catering to the evolving needs of the sector.
In a recent move towards fostering collaboration and innovation, Cascade Space released the spacelink Python library as open-source. This library contains essential functions for communication system analysis, enhancing the capabilities of the Cascade Portal implementation.
